I was green with envy at those smart cookies sporting an iPad wherever they go. I do a lot of writing and I like the tactile feedback of a proper keyboard. Squinting at a screen covered with slimy fingerprints isn't my idea of productivity either.
So for a third of the price I got a micro laptop. It runs 3 operating systems: Windows 7, Android and Linux Ubuntu. I dislike Apple for their obnoxious ways in cultivating a captive audience of customers. It started with the iPod. I just gave up on iTunes. Why can't you just drag and drop MP3 files between your hard disk and the USB memory? Why do they have to mangle the filenames beyond recognition? But I have discovered that Mircrosoft and Google are just playing the same silly games. Migrating from Vista to Windows 7 I discovered that Microsoft Mail was missing on purpose. They want to leverage their hotmail portal and copy what Google did with Gmail. Then they also remove the ability to change the desktop background as an incentive to part with cash to upgrade from the Windows 7 Starter version... Fortunately there is a free utility to download to do just that. I also used Thunderbird mail client made by the same people who released the Firefox web browser. Of course for a $250 micro PC I am not paying for a Microsoft Office license. I use Open Office instead... The Android operating system is an abomination. I used it on my Samsung phone for 6 months but for a tablet it is next to useless. There are no native applications for word processing, spreadsheet and the like. Even though it is a port of Linux the Open Office suite isn't available for it. Furthermore in order to use Android Market you have to have a device registered against your Gmail address. So every time I try to download something on the micro PC it ends up on my phone instead. In their attempt to rule the world and track who downloads what they forgot to figure out the same person might use more than one android device... If you take the time to download the entire CD for Linux Ubuntu you will have a pleasant surprise. It loads real fast and comes complete with a suite of applications to do computing on the go. It has a multi boot utility so you can pick and chose which operating system to run at startup. Cloud computing has a dark side to it. Big brother wants to monitor everything you do. In the future people might use their gmail address to transmit bogus emails to fool eavesdroppers as to their real activities... In the meantime we have to put up with idiotic behaviours from marketing behemoths who think they own their user base and can make us do what they want.
